    Southern Utah is one of the most photographed and visited regions in the American West, thanks to its dramatic canyons, arches, and desert landscapes. From Zion to small towns like Kanab and Mexican Hat, this area is full of surprises and local charm.

    1. Land of the “Mighty Five”

    Southern Utah is home to most of Utah’s famous “Mighty Five” national parks: Zion, Bryce Canyon, Capitol Reef, Arches, and Canyonlands are all located in the southern half of the state or easily accessed from Southern Utah hubs like St. George and Moab. These parks draw millions of visitors each year for world-class hiking, canyoneering, and scenic drives.

    2. Red Rock That Looks Like Mars

    Many people compare Southern Utah’s red rock deserts to the surface of Mars because of the deep canyons, towering cliffs, and strange rock formations. The region’s otherworldly landscape has been used as a testing ground for Mars-related research and film projects due to its rugged, alien look.

    3. Zion National Park’s Iconic Trails

    Zion National Park is one of the crown jewels of Southern Utah and is known for famous trails like Angels Landing and The Narrows. Visitors come from all over the world to hike through slot canyons, wade the Virgin River, and stand beneath sheer sandstone walls that glow at sunrise and sunset.

    4. Bryce Canyon’s Hoodoo Wonderland

    Bryce Canyon National Park is famous for its “hoodoos,” tall, thin rock spires that fill natural amphitheaters in shades of red, orange, and white. These formations are especially stunning at sunrise, making Bryce a favorite destination for photographers and stargazers.

    Capitol Reef’s Hidden Orchards and Cliffs

    Capitol Reef National Park combines dramatic cliffs and canyons with historic orchards planted by early settlers in the Fruita district. In season, visitors can wander among fruit trees, pick produce, and enjoy fresh pies surrounded by rugged sandstone scenery.

    Grand Staircase–Escalante’s Wild Backcountry

    Grand Staircase–Escalante National Monument covers a massive area of canyons, plateaus, and slot canyons stretching across Southern Utah. This lesser-visited region is a paradise for hikers and backpackers looking for hidden arches, remote waterfalls, and true backcountry solitude.

    Lake Powell and Glen Canyon Adventures

    Southern Utah provides access to Lake Powell and Glen Canyon National Recreation Area, a huge reservoir surrounded by red rock cliffs, coves, and side canyons. Boating, kayaking, paddleboarding, and camping on sandy beaches make this one of the region’s premier water destinations.

    Small Towns with Big Character

    Southern Utah is dotted with memorable small towns like Kanab, Springdale, Moab, and Mexican Hat. Many of these communities are known for their proximity to national parks, local festivals, film history, and unique rock formations that inspired their names.

    A Hotspot for Slot Canyons

    Southern Utah is world-famous for its narrow slot canyons—twisting passages carved through sandstone that can be only a few feet wide. Popular areas include canyons near Zion, Escalante, and Page, where visitors can experience swirling walls, reflected light, and sculpted rock formations.

    International Dark Sky Destinations

    The remote deserts and high plateaus of Southern Utah offer some of the darkest night skies in the United States. Several parks and communities in the region have earned International Dark Sky status, making stargazing and Milky Way photography major draws for visitors.

    Dinosaur Fossils and Ancient History

    Southern Utah is rich in dinosaur fossils, trackways, and paleontology sites, with museums and dig locations scattered across the region. Fossil beds, preserved footprints, and exhibits help visitors imagine what this desert looked like millions of years ago.

    Petroglyphs and Native American Heritage

    Throughout Southern Utah, you can find petroglyphs and rock art panels left by Native American cultures that lived in the region for thousands of years. These sites, found near canyons, cliffs, and rivers, provide a powerful connection to the area’s deep human history.

    Outdoor Playground All Year Long

    Thanks to its lower elevation deserts and higher elevation plateaus, Southern Utah offers year-round outdoor activities. In a single season, you can hike in red rock canyons, mountain bike on slickrock, and escape summer heat by heading to higher, cooler forests and viewpoints.

    Scenic Byways and Road Trips

    Southern Utah is crisscrossed by scenic highways and byways that make road trips unforgettable. Routes like Scenic Byway 12, which connects Bryce Canyon and Capitol Reef through dramatic canyons and high ridges, are often called some of the most beautiful drives in America.

    A Magnet for Adventure Seekers

    Whether it’s canyoneering, rock climbing, mountain biking, off-roading, or trail running, Southern Utah is a magnet for adventure enthusiasts. Towns like Moab and St. George have grown into outdoor hubs with guide services, gear shops, and events that celebrate the region’s active lifestyle.

    15 Fun & Interesting Facts about Eastern Idaho

    Coming to Idaho? There is a lot to explore!

    1. Gateway to Yellowstone & the Tetons: Eastern Idaho is the perfect launching point for adventures in Yellowstone National Park and the Teton Range, offering easy access to some of the country’s most iconic landscapes.
    2. Waterfalls Galore: Mesa Falls, a pair of impressive waterfalls on Henry’s Fork, showcases cascades formed by ancient volcanic activity and offers awe-inspiring scenic views.
    3. Craters of the Moon National Monument: This otherworldly volcanic landscape lets you explore lava tubes, cinder cones, and surreal black rock fields—making you feel like you’ve landed on another planet.
    4. Bishop Mountain Lookout: Near Island Park, you can visit the historic Bishop Mountain wildfire lookout tower, now on the National Register of Historic Places, and enjoy spectacular panoramic mountain views.
    5. St. Anthony Sand Dunes: Spread over 10,000 acres, these white quartz sand dunes are a hot spot for off-road vehicles and even made an appearance in the cult classic film “Napoleon Dynamite”.
    6. Idaho Falls Greenbelt: The scenic riverwalk along the Snake River in Idaho Falls includes waterfalls, the Japanese Friendship Garden, and peaceful rock gardens—ideal for strolls and photos.
    7. Bear Lake: Known as the “Caribbean of the Rockies” for its bright turquoise water, Bear Lake straddles the Idaho-Utah border and is a popular summer playground.
    8. Wildlife Encounters: You can see grizzly and black bears up close at Yellowstone Bear World in Rexburg, or catch sight of hundreds of bird species throughout the region.
    9. The Museum of Idaho: Located in Idaho Falls, this top-rated museum features exhibits on local history, science, and culture, plus interactive experiences for families.
    10. Historic Pioneer Trails: Eastern Idaho is crossed by segments of the Oregon Trail and other historic routes, with visible wagon ruts from 1800s settlers—perfect for history buffs.
    11. Stunning Hot Springs: There are numerous natural hot springs to enjoy across the region, such as Green Canyon near Rexburg—ideal for relaxing after a day of exploring.
    12. Unique Geological Features: The area boasts the largest volcanic caldera in the continental U.S. and fascinating remnants from the 1959 Yellowstone earthquake, like “Quake Lake”.
    13. Island Park’s Mighty Caldera: Island Park, with its massive caldera, boasts the “longest Main Street in America” at over 33 miles—great for exploring, boating, and snow sports.
    14. Huckleberry Treats: Eastern Idaho is famous for wild huckleberries and local shops offering everything from milkshakes to jams and chocolates made with these tasty native berries.
    15. Family-Friendly Fun: The region is packed with family attractions like historic carousels, drive-in movie theaters, and seasonal festivals. The Spud Drive-In in Driggs is a local favorite for classic movie nights under the stars.

    The “Cheap” U-Haul Myth: What You See vs. What You Pay

    U-Haul loves to advertise those “starting at $19.95” signs. Sounds great, right?
    But as anyone who’s rented one knows — that’s like saying a burger “starts” at $1.99 before you add fries, cheese, and, you know, the burger part.

    Here’s what you actually pay for with a U-Haul rental:

    • Mileage charges: Usually around $0.79 per mile or more (and that adds up fast).
    • Fuel costs: You’ve got to refill the tank before returning it.
    • Insurance: Because you definitely don’t want to explain that scratch on the bumper.
    • Dolly, blankets, and equipment rentals: Yep, those cost extra too.
    • Your time: Loading, driving, unloading, and returning the truck = your entire weekend.

    When you put it all together, that “cheap” $19.95 rental can easily turn into hundreds of dollars, plus the cost of pizza for your friends who helped (and possibly therapy for your back). You will be lucky to rent a U-Haul or any moving truck and keeping the cost of that rental under $80. It is near impossible

    Are U-Boxes Cheaper than Hiring Movers?

    Uboxes have different options for long distance moving, but the prices range drastically when moving long distance. So here are some things to take into account:

    • How many U-Boxes do you need? – Many times if you are moving cross-country and you go over 2 boxes then you could probably have hired movers to do the whole move for cheaper.
    • Will everything fit? – Pay attention to the dimensions of the boxes, because we helped a lady who got 10 U-Boxes and then we had a really nice 10 Foot table that wouldn’t fit so she had to find a way to get her table shipped last minute.
    • Do you have packing skills? – When loading a U-box, they have to be loaded with the weight balanced and they can’t be overloaded or they make you repack things. Also things have to be packed in a way that damage won’t occur while the box is lifted, tilted, and bounced on forklifts or in a semi.

    Step 4: Verify Licensing and Insurance

    This step matters.
    A “moving company” without insurance is just a group of guys with strong opinions and access to a pickup truck.

    Legitimate companies should have:

    • A USDOT number (for interstate moves)
    • State licensing when required
    • Proof of liability insurance
    • cargo insurance (for interstate moves)
    • Employees covered by workers’ compensation

    If they dance around the licensing question, that’s your sign to not dance with them.

    2. Verify Credentials and Licensing

    For interstate moves, any professional long-distance moving company must be registered with the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) and possess a valid USDOT number. Always verify:

    • FMCSA licensing
    • USDOT number
    • Insurance coverage (liability and cargo)
    • Memberships with reputable organizations like the American Moving & Storage Association (AMSA) or the Better Business Bureau (BBB) are ways you can ensure that you are hiring a moving company that won’t take your money and run.

    These credentials indicate that a professional moving company adheres to industry standards and regulations.

    4. Get Multiple In-Home Estimates

    Reputable moving companies should provide a binding estimate after conducting an in-home or virtual survey of your belongings. Be wary of companies that only offer quotes over the phone or email without seeing your inventory as many of these companies will sometimes double their estimates the day of the move. Compare multiple estimates to:

    • Identify average pricing
    • Detect unusually low-ball offers (a potential red flag for moving scams)
    • Understand the range of moving services included

    Ask for a binding not-to-exceed estimate to avoid unexpected costs. Manly Moving excels at offering accurate estimates with transparent fees so there are no surprises.


    5. Understand the Pricing Structure

    Long-distance moving costs are typically based on:

    • Weight of your shipment or cubic feet of your shipment
    • Distance of the move
    • Additional services (packing, storage, special handling)
    • Timing (peak season vs. off-season or express delivery)

    Request a detailed moving quote that itemizes all charges. Ensure there are no hidden fees or ambiguous terms in the moving contract.


    6. Evaluate Insurance and Liability Options

    Even with the most careful professional movers, accidents can happen. Understand the insurance options:

    • Released Value Protection: Basic coverage at no additional cost but minimal compensation. The released value is usually around $0.60/lbs, but some areas may offer a slightly higher or lower valuation.
    • Full Value Protection: More comprehensive coverage that ensures repair, replacement, or reimbursement for lost or damaged items.
    • Third-party insurance: Additional coverage for high-value items.

    Ensure you fully understand what each option covers before signing the moving agreement.


    7. Watch for Red Flags

    Be cautious of moving companies that:

    • Demand large upfront deposits (Greater than 30% down)
    • Lack proper licensing and insurance
    • Have vague or confusing contracts
    • Use unmarked or rented trucks
    • Offer significantly lower quotes than competitors
    • Refuse to conduct an in-person estimate

    These warning signs may indicate moving scams or unprofessional operators. At Manly Moving we are here to help you. If you want us even to look at another estimate for you and expose any red flags we are happy to help. Even if we don’t move you we still want to help. No one should be scammed.

    Note: All long-distance or cross country moving companies are required to give you access to 2 documents which are “Your Rights and Responsibilities When You Move” and “Ready to Move”. You can download and review these great documents by clicking here.


    8. Review the Contract Thoroughly

    Before committing to any long-distance mover, read the Bill of Lading carefully. This legally binding document should include:

    • Estimated delivery dates
    • Itemized list of services and charges
    • Insurance coverage details
    • Cancellation and claims policies

    Don’t hesitate to ask for clarification on any confusing terms.

    Note: Another tip is to avoid going through a moving broker. They sell off your move to moving companies and often don’t vet those companies to see if they are quality, honest companies. This is where a lot of scams and property hostage situations arise. So when calling to book with a company online ask if they are a moving broker because they will often try to conceal this fact.

    1. Local Moving Services

    If you’re moving within your city or nearby areas, local moving services are tailored to make short-distance moves easy and stress-free. Around 90 % of moving companies will offer local moving services that include:

    • Secure loading and unloading
    • Transportation (Ask if they provide the moving truck or if you need to provide it)
    • Same-day moves (this will vary largely on the moving company and the time of year you are moving, and the size of you move)
    • Fragile item handling (Ask your movers how they protect fragile items. Crating services are not a common service offered by moving companies)
    • Furniture disassembly and reassembly (Ask the moving company if they come with tools or if you need to provide them)

    2. Long-Distance Moving Services

    Long-distance moves require meticulous planning and expert coordination.

    • Interstate and cross-country moves (Lot of moving companies may offer these services, but not a ton of them do it legally. Make sure you moving company is licensed with DOT and have cargo and commercial auto coverage so you don’t risk losing everything.)
    • Dedicated moving coordinator (Not all moving companies have dedicated sales reps to coordinate your move. You want good communication with a long-distance move. This will vary per company, but is something important to keep in mind.)
    • Climate-controlled transportation options (This is very rare and won’t matter for most things you transport unless you transport things like plants and animals. I would go as far as to say you generally hire specific moving companies that specialize in this because it is not common.)
    • Timely delivery (This varies a lot with long-distance moving companies. If you hire a vanline with shared loads you will generally be looking at less timely delivery timeframes. If you are not sharing a load then a majority of moving companies can give you a decent timely delivery.)

    3. Residential Moving Services

    Your home is full of valuable belongings that deserve careful handling. Our residential moving services include:

    • Customized moving plans ( It can be difficult to coordinate timelines when buying and selling a house at the same time. Most moving companies deal with a wide array of these situations and can have great advice for navigating your move.)
    • Full-service packing (75% of moving companies will offer full service packing. A way lower percent of those moving companies will provide packing materials at an affordable rate. )
    • Specialty item moving (Pianos, gun safes, spas, antiques, and fine art are among some of the specialty moving that moving companies can offer. Due to the liability and skill involved in moving such items you need to ask your moving company if they offer these services and it should not be assumed that they will move them.)
    • Secure storage solutions (This is a service less than half of moving companies offer and usually it is the bigger companies that will offer it. Check with your moving company to see if they have secure and climate controlled storage.)
    • Moving insurance options (Very few moving companies offer moving insurance directly. All legit moving companies are required to offer valuation coverage, but that is different than insurance and usually moving insurance if it is purchased it is purchased through a 3rd party like http://www.movinginsurance.com.)

    5. Packing & Unpacking Services

    Packing can be one of the most time-consuming parts of moving. Let our professional team handle it with:

    • Full-service packing (Ask if your movers provide moving supplies or not and ask to see their box prices before ordering)
    • Partial packing options (Van Lines are some of the only moving companies I have seen that won’t do a partial pack, but who offer full-pack services. You can generally assume if the moving company does a full-pack then they will offer a partial packing service. )
    • Fragile Item Packing (Not all moving companies will be experienced or know how to protect certain fragile items in transit. Identify your most fragile items and ask how your movers would protect such an item)
    • Custom crating for high-value items (Crating is not a common service offered by moving companies and you want a moving company that has experience crating or it will be money wasted crating something if it is not done right.
    • Unpacking Service (This service is really hit or miss as to whether a moving company will offer this service. For example we will only offer this service during slow periods. )

    6. Storage Solutions

    Sometimes you need a safe place to store your items temporarily.

    • Short-term and long-term storage (Larger moving companies will have storage options while smaller moving companies generally wont. Ask your moving company if their storage facility is owned or leased by them or if they are just storing your items at a self storage facility.)
    • Climate-controlled storage units (Climate Controlled storage is not a common service that moving companies can offer. If a moving company stores in a warehouse they will likely have climate controlled storage.)
    • 24/7 security monitoring (Ask your movers if their storage facility has security cameras or security system in place)
    • Easy access when you need it (Generally if your moving company stores you items in a moving vault then you will need to usually give 24 hours notice. If you are storing in a storage facility then access is usually a lot easier and advance notice is not required.)

    7. Specialty Moving Services

    Some items need extra care and expertise.

    • Pianos and organs (Lots of moving companies will move pianos and organs for an added piano fee. That being said not all moving companies have the right equipment to safely move pianos and organs. If you have a grand piano or a larger upright piano that requires so tricky maneuvering or if it is a high end piano then hire a moving company that has pictures of them moving those types of items on their website. )
    • Fine art and sculptures (Most smaller moving companies won’t have the insurance to handle a claim even if they do claim that they move these types of items. Ask you movers about their liability and commercial auto insurance before trusting them to move such items.)
    • Pool tables (Pool tables you need more than muscle to move. Most moving companies will move a disassembled pool table, but you need to find a company that has experience assembling and disassembling them so that the table is accurately leveled and the felt is tight.)
    • Hot tubs (Hot tubs can range a ton in weight especially when you get into the swim spas. If you get into moving these same items in trick terrain then an experienced moving company is necessary. Most moving companies can move a 4 person hot tub without too much trouble, but bigger then that you need the right movers with the right equipment.)
    • Grandfather clocks (I added this because these are often moved and they are often moved incorrectly. They are not hard to move, but you need to know the right way to move them and so each company will vary if they have trained their movers on how to move them or not.
    • Oversized furniture (Depending on the weight and size of the item and the path that item needs to take from A to B will determine the level of experience you movers will need to have.)

    Average Moving Company Costs in 2025

    How much does it cost to hire movers in 2025? The answer depends on several factors, but here are national averages you can expect:

    Type of MoveAverage Cost Range
    Local Move (Under 100 Miles)$500 – $2,500
    Long-Distance Move (100+ Miles)$2,000 – $8,000+
    International Move$4,000 – $15,000+
    Studio/1-Bedroom Move$400 – $1,200
    2-3 Bedroom Home Move$1,200 – $5,000
    4+ Bedroom Move$2,000 – $10,000+

    Important Tip:
    Prices vary based on your location, season, and whether you choose full-service movers or basic transportation-only service.


    What Determines Moving Costs?

    1️⃣ Distance

    • Local Moves are typically charged by the hour.
    • Long-Distance Moves are priced based on weight, volume, and miles traveled.

    2️⃣ Size of Your Move

    The size of your home directly affects cost. More rooms = more boxes, furniture, and weight.

    Average Moving Weight:

    • Studio Apartment: ~2,000 lbs
    • 2-Bedroom Home: ~5,000 lbs
    • 4-Bedroom Home: 10,000–15,000 lbs

    3️⃣ Time of Year

    • Peak Season (May–September): Higher demand = higher prices.
    • Off-Peak (October–April): You can often save 20–30%.

    4️⃣ Labor and Crew Size

    • Larger crews move you faster but cost more per hour.
    • Difficult access (stairs, elevators, long carries) increases labor time.

    5️⃣ Packing Services

    • Full-service packing: $300 – $1,200+
    • Packing supplies: $100 – $500 depending on home size.

    6️⃣ Insurance & Valuation Coverage

    • Basic coverage may not be enough.
    • Full value protection typically costs ~1% of your declared item value.

    Detailed Cost Breakdown Examples

    Example 1: Local Move (2-Bedroom Apartment, 5 Hours)

    • 3 movers @ $175/hour: $875
    • Packing supplies: $200
    • Truck fee: $150
    • Insurance upgrade: $75

    Total: $1,300

    Example 2: Long-Distance Move (3-Bedroom Home, 1,000 Miles)

    • 8,000 lbs @ $0.75/lb: $6,000
    • Packing service: $800
    • Materials: $300
    • Fuel surcharge: $250
    • Insurance: $300
    • Additional handling: $200

    Total: $7,850


    Hidden Moving Fees to Watch Out For

    Extra ChargeCost RangeReason
    Stairs Fee$50–$200Multiple flights of stairs
    Long Carry Fee$75–$200Long distance from truck to door
    Elevator Fee$50–$150Apartment moves
    Heavy Item Fee$100–$500Pianos, safes, pool tables
    Storage$100–$500/monthTemporary storage needs
    Shuttle Fee$200–$500Small truck required for tight access

    How to Save Money on Your Move

    Proven money-saving moving tips:

    1. Declutter – Fewer items = lower weight and cost.
    2. Move Off-Peak – Schedule your move between October and April.
    3. Book Early – Lock in lower rates by reserving in advance.
    4. Pack Yourself – Save on packing labor.
    5. Use Free Boxes – Get free boxes from local stores or online groups.
    6. Compare Multiple Quotes – Get at least 3 estimates.
    7. Be Flexible – Mid-week, mid-month moves often cost less.
    8. Ask for Discounts – Seniors, military, students, and repeat customers often qualify.
